food court bailiff posted:So if I want to play WMHIII do I need like, upgrade cards like Malifaux or something or just the new rules or how does this dumb hobby work. I had the Hordes starter with the angry wolfmen and the blind dragon badasses and an extra blind dragon badass magnetized to switch between his two options. Warmachine Mk3 rules are free online I believe. Points and stuff changed, you can buy a card deck from stores/online with the new stats for everything that was around at the start, or you can buy the decks for cheaper on the app and just play using a phone/tablet. Also at some point soon (next few months, summer?) all the cards will be free online and you will be able to print them yourself if you want.
